What volume of `CO_(2)` at `STP` is obtained by thermal decomposition of `20g KHCO_(3)` to `CO_(2)& H_(2)O` [Atomic mass `K = 39]` .

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

Write balanced reaction : `{:(2KHCO_(3)(s),overset(Delta)rarr,K_(2)O(s)+,2CO_(2)(g),+H_(2)O(g)),(20g=0.2mol,,0.2mol,,):}`
Vol of `CO_(2) = 0.2 xx 22.4 = 4.48 L` .
